Haggerty, Eckman, Mooney doubles tandem remain alive in district play


Staff report

CANTON

Day one of the Northeast Ohio Division II district tennis tournament at Canton’s Harvard Park ended without a Mahoning Valley representative advancing past the second round.

In singles play, Kacie Haggerty of Cardinal Mooney defeated Anjali Kashyap of Orange High 6-1, 6-2 in the first round before falling to Ariana Iranpour of Hathaway Brown in the quarterfinal 6-0, 6-0.

Hallie Yerian, also of Mooney, fell to Sydney Green of Hawken 6-0, 6-1 in the first round and Gianna Reider of Mooney dropped a 6-2, 6-0 match to Anna Pietsch of Chagrin Falls.

Poland’s Elise Eckman defeated Canton South’s Tessa Hollinger 6-7 (5), 6-2, 6-4 then lost to Laurel’s Danielle Buchinsky 6-0, 6-2 later in the day.

Haggerty will play Green today and the winner of Eckman and Neya Sterling, of Louisville St. Thomas Aquinas, to determine the district’s third, fourth and fifth place finishers.

In doubles play, the Cardinals featured two participants.

Lexi Kleeh and Lizzie Matthews won their first-round match 6-4, 6-4 over Sarah Adler and Megan Callanan of Hathaway Brown. The Mooney duo lost in quarterfinal play Adrian young and Alissa Nakamoto of Orange 6-0, 6-1.

Jamie DiDomenico and Dominique Cicchi lost a three-setter to Hawken’s Marshall Rankin and Nayana Ravishankar 7-5, 6-1, 7-5.

The Lakeview tandem of Lauren Paczak and Carlie Stein fell 6-3, 6-2 to Catherin Areklett and Ally Persky of Hathaway Brown.

The Kleeh-Matthews duo plays Amy Varckette and Alyx Lynham of Geneva and the winner of the Revere-Hawken doubles match, if necessary, today to determine the third, fourth and fifth-place winners.
